Activities & Mission

To primarily relieve poverty and promote and protect good health by providing a retreat centre for those most in need of a place of safety, family reconnection or a break from the stresses of every day life.With life skills courses on budgeting, job seeking and eating healthy on a budget and providing items / goods as appropriate in order to relieve poverty which they could not otherwise afford

Frequently asked questions about Beyond Limits

What does Beyond Limits do?

To primarily relieve poverty and promote and protect good health by providing a retreat centre for those most in need of a place of safety, family reconnection or a break from the stresses of every day life.With life skills courses on budgeting, job seeking and eating healthy on a budget and providing items / goods as appropriate in order to relieve poverty which they could not otherwise afford

How much income did Beyond Limits report in 2025?

Beyond Limits reported total income of £193k and reported expenditure of £160k for the financial year ending 2025, based on the most recent annual return filed with the Charity Commission.

When was Beyond Limits registered as a charity?

Beyond Limits was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 30 August 2016 as charity number 1168962. It has been registered for 10 years.

Who runs Beyond Limits?

Beyond Limits is governed by a board of 5 trustees. The chair of trustees is MALCOLM WELDON.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.

Where does Beyond Limits operate?

Beyond Limits operates across 3 areas: Darlington, Durham and Stockton-on-tees.

Is Beyond Limits a registered charity?

Yes — Beyond Limits is a registered charity in England and Wales, charity number 1168962.
